In 2019-2020, 1,279 people earned their degree in General classics and classical languages, literatures, and linguistics, making the major the 352nd most popular in the United States.

At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 83 General classics and classical languages, literatures, and linguistics graduates with average earnings and debt of $72,680 and $116,043 respectively.
